Product Details
- Name: Primpex, Co-trimoxazole (Sulfamethoxazole and Trimethoprim)
- How It Works: Primpex (referring here to the Co-trimoxazole formulation) is a synergistic antibacterial combination. The two active ingredients block two sequential steps in the bacterial synthesis of folic acid, an essential nutrient for the bacteria to survive and multiply. This effectively stops bacterial growth and kills the infection.

- Warning:
- This is a prescription-only medicine and must only be used under a doctor’s supervision.
- Allergy: Do not use if you are allergic to sulfonamides (sulfa drugs) or trimethoprim.
- Side Effects: May cause severe, potentially life-threatening skin rashes (e.g., Stevens-Johnson syndrome); seek immediate medical attention if a rash develops.
- Complete the course: The full course of antibiotics must be completed, even if symptoms improve early, to prevent antibiotic resistance.
- Fluid Intake: Drink plenty of water while taking this medication to prevent kidney stones.
